Main Goal

The main goal of the living machine is to be a sustainable alternative to conventional waste disposal.

It also provides an educational opportunity from its simulation of ecosystems.

What it does The living machine takes wastewater and

purifies it to a point where it can be directly discharged into waterways or can be recycled

It does so by utilizing a set of created ecologies

Each system is designed specifically depending on the type of wastewater it will treat. http://www.livingmachines.com/

How it works1. Anaerobic settling tank – this tank allows solids

to fall out of the wastewater and sink to the bottom allowing it to become clearer.

2. A Biofilter of bark and other soil-like materials –this is the first filtration and first step to help reduce the odor

3. Photosynthetic algae tank –fix oxygen back into the water and provide organic food (dead algae) for respiration

How it works cont’d4. Higher plants (typically water hyacinth) in

aerobic tanks grow in a nutrient solution -provide a stable environment for microbes and remove heavy metals from the water.

5. Microbes are an ideal source of food for plankton which are ideal sources for filter feeding fish

6. This creates the ability for detritus-feeding fish to be added in later tanks so they may consume the larger sections of the treated sludge.

Technological obstacles

Most living machines require a greenhouse or other structure to protect it from colder weather.

Minimal exposure to the environment so it has been unable to become a true ecosystem with natural selection and self-design and management.

Political/Economic obstinacies

The psychological effect of being able to drink your own wastewater.

Traditional wastewater treatments have been embedded into our economy.

The living system could have difficulty breaking through the mass scale of traditional systems.

Costly to construct
